[zz]winform 窗体关闭事件】的更多相关文章

注册窗体关闭事件: 在Form1.Designer.cs 文件中添加: this.FormClosing += new System.Windows.Forms.FormClosingEventHandler(this.Form1_FormClosing); 然后在form1中添加方法: private void Form1_FormClosing(object sender, FormClosingEventArgs e)        {            some code;     …
//窗体关闭前事件 private void FrmMain_FormClosing(object sender, FormClosingEventArgs e) { DialogResult result = MessageBox.Show("确认退出吗?", "退出询问", MessageBoxButtons.OKCancel, MessageBoxIcon.Question); if(result == DialogResult.Cancel) { e.Can…
在窗体中有FormClosing这个事件,这个事件是在窗体关闭时候运行的.如果要取消某个事件的操作,那么就在该事件中写上e.Cancel=true就能取消该事件,也就是不执行该事件.所以,你要在窗体关闭时候,跳出一个窗口提示是否关闭窗体,如果选择不关闭,那么写上e.Cancel=true就可以了,如果选择关闭,那么写上e.Cancel=false. 示例代码: using System; using System.Collections.Generic; using System.Compone…
在窗体的关闭事件FormClosing中进行判断,FormClosing事件每当用户关闭窗体时,在窗体已关闭并指定关闭原因前发生. private void Form1_FormClosing(object sender, FormClosingEventArgs e) { DialogResult r = MessageBox.Show("是否关闭窗体?", "提示", MessageBoxButtons.YesNo); if (r == DialogResult…
1.进行.net窗体的开发,经常用到鼠标事件,如MouseDown/MouseUp/MouseMove/MouseClick等.可是有时候给控件添加鼠标事件,就是不响应,怎么办呢! 答案:1.控件是否可见,即不能被子控件遮挡,若已经被遮挡,可以在子控件中将鼠标事件调用父控件的OnMouseMove等方法对父控件的鼠标事件进行重写 2.尝试在MouseEnter事件中将控件设置为输入焦点(Focus试试) 2.MouseDown.MouseMove.MouseUp三个事件是如何响应的? 答案:经测…
switch (e.CloseReason) { case CloseReason.None: break; case CloseReason.WindowsShutDown: break; case CloseReason.MdiFormClosing: break; case CloseReason.UserClosing: break; case CloseReason.TaskManagerClosing: break; case CloseReason.FormOwnerClosing…
/// <summary> /// 快捷键操作 /// </summary> protected override bool ProcessCmdKey(ref Message msg, Keys keyData) { switch (keyData) { // 标记为起点 case Keys.Z: btnSignStart_Click(null, null); break; // 标记终点 case Keys.X: btnSignEnd_Click(null, null); br…
Application.Idle += Application_Idle; void Application_Idle(object sender, EventArgs e){ } 当应用程序完成处理并即将进入空闲状态时发生.…
在js脚本里全局定义一个 var r=true;若是刷新的话则把r=false; $(window).unload(function () { if (r) { //这里面证明用户不是点的F5刷新 执行你的操作 $.ajax({ type: "Post", url: "/BillInfo/ClearSession.html", error: function () { alert("出错"); }, success: function (data…
<script type="text/javascript">   <!--         window.onbeforeunload = onbeforeunload_handler;    window.onunload = onunload_handler;    function onbeforeunload_handler() {        var warning = "退出吗?";        return warning;  …